The Sub-Zero BI-48SID-S-TH is a high-performance built-in refrigerator designed to provide optimal food preservation with advanced cooling technology. It features dual refrigeration systems, a sleek stainless steel finish, and customizable storage options. Below are key sections for safety, features, installation, setup, operation, and troubleshooting.
Key components: Dual refrigeration system, adjustable shelving, water filtration system, LED lighting, and a touch control panel.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Dual Refrigeration | Separate systems for refrigerator and freezer for optimal temperature control |
| Adjustable Shelving | Customizable storage options to accommodate various food items |
| Water Filtration | Built-in water filter for clean and fresh ice and water |
| LED Lighting | Bright and energy-efficient lighting for better visibility |
| Touch Control Panel | Easy-to-use interface for temperature and settings adjustments |

|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Refrigerator not cooling | Power supply issue | Check power connection and circuit breaker. |
| Water dispenser not working | Clogged filter | Replace water filter and check connections. |
| Ice maker not producing ice | Water supply issue | Ensure water line is connected and turned on. |
| Noise from refrigerator | Improper leveling | Adjust leveling legs for stability. |
